I need some help. I have had patella tendonitis in my knees for 2 years. Last september I sprained my AC joint in my shoulder lifting, and then a month later completely tore my patella tendon in my knee while jumping. It's been 3 months since my surgery and earlier this week I had a cortisone shot to alleviate my shoulder, then literally the next day my other shoulder starting having the same pain as the one I screwed up my AC joint in. Why is my body detorioraing like this? I am 23 years old, I can't even go to the gym bc my body is so wrecked right now. Any ideas?

Are you sleeping enough? I had no end of problems with tendonitis in my wrist whilst at Uni because of the workload I was pushing my body mentally and physically with long work hours practicing/recording + a lot of typing/computer work/4-5 hours sleep max a night and still working out - eventually I got glandular fever - possibly because of how run down I was...I have since learned I need to let my body rest when I'm feeling drained etc and consequently I am in far better health because of this.
